Farmers Markets of the Region
The hustle and bustle of a farmers’ market offers a festive weekly shopping experience. Farmers’ markets bring together growers, food processors and other artisans to provide you with a wealth of food and product choices. You can shop for the best price, seek out speciality or heirloom crop varieties and take advantage of the expertise of farmers. Cooking tips, side dish suggestions and serving advice are all available for the asking from the folks who grow your food.
Summer or Winter, you can buy local farm products directly from the farmer at the Region's many vibrant farmers' markets. Downtown Rutland hosts the only 52 week farmers' market, found in Depot park during the spring, summer and fall and inside the Strand Theather during the winter.

Rutland Downtown Farmers’ Market
Depot Park
SATURDAYS 9 am-2 pm, TUESDAYS 3-6 pm
www.vtfarmersmarket.org
www.rutlandcountyfarmersmarket.org
Two farmers’ market organizations join forces for this bustling market! The Vermont Farmers’ Market occupies the northern end of the market, while the Rutland County Farmers’ Market is on the southern end. Combined, the market is one of Vermont’s largest and most diverse farmers’ markets, bringing together in one place over 80 vendors offering high quality vegetables and fruits in season, eggs, cheese, poultry & meat, mushrooms, honey, maple syrup, cut flowers, herbs, annuals, perennials, and more. Bakers provide delicious, oven fresh breads, rolls, cookies, pies and other sweet treats. Also find specialty value-added products, local crafts and artwork, and hot food! EBT and debit cards accepted.
